Distributed denial of service (DDoS) assaults continue to be a nuisance for online businesses and their customers. Worse, the downtime caused by attacks is costly for organizations and frustrating for consumers.
Q2 2015 Global DDoS Threat Landscape: Assaults Resemble Advanced Persistent Threats
